What is Trainzilla Mcp?
Trainzilla Mcp connects Claude (or any MCP-compatible AI) to your Trainzilla coaching account, allowing you to manage clients, workout plans, diet plans, sessions, habits, and billing using plain English — no scripts or token paste required.
How to use Trainzilla Mcp?
Add the MCP endpoint https://api.tzilla.live/mcp in Claude.ai’s connectors section (claude.ai/customize/connectors), name it “Trainzilla”, and connect via OAuth 2.0 one-click consent. No manual tokens needed.

What transport and authentication does Trainzilla Mcp use?
Transport: Stateless Streamable HTTP. Auth: OAuth 2.0 with PKCE (S256) and dynamic client registration (RFC 7591). No manual token paste required.
